The absolute laureate of the 58th Pula Film Festival
The winner of the Great Golden Arena on this year’s Pula featured film festival – the humorous drama “Kotlovina” of director Tomislav Radić, was shown as part of the accompanying program of the 62nd Dubrovnik Summer Festival on Saturday, the 30th of July, in the Visia Cinema.
The movie of director and screenplay editor Tomislav Radić is an absolute laureate of the mid section of the National program of the Pula festival of featured film where it has been awarded with an astonishing six Golden Arena’s – the Great Golden Arena for best movie was given to Tomislav Radić, for best female role to Mirela Brekalo Popović, for the role of Ana, for best male role to Draško Zidar for the role of Mirko, for best supporting role to Boris Buzančić for the role of Dida, while a special Golden Arena has been awarded for tone, to Frano Homen. The movie “Kotlovina” has received the Oktavijan award of the Croatian Society of film critics.
As is stated in the explanation of the decision, the movie “Kotlovina” has won the award for best movie due to the “style, idea and direction, couple with a convincing show of one seemingly unimportant family dynamic that, as whole defines the country we live in today”. The entrance was free.
